our is a small pvt ltd firm with only 3 employees (but a part of very large real state group), mumbai. we are into facilitily management (Service provider).
We do not have ESI because of high pay and less no of manpower.
So is it mandatory to us to take workmen compensation policy if yes then what are the policies, compnies which provided it.
Is there any any abstract or notification by government to support this ?

As per the defenition of employee those (viii) employed in the construction, maintenance, repair or demolition of - (a) any building which is designed to be or is or has been more than one story in height above the ground or twelve feet or more from the ground level to the apex of the roof is included.
Facility Management will come within the meaning of Maintenance .
It is better that you take out the policy . In case the Insurer i.e the Insurance Company is not offering it then you can go in for Accident Benefit Policy .
